Hate to see you chop down the 410 because they are a little rarer than the other guages, if you cannot find another barrel for it, you might consider looking for an old remington 870 or mossberg 500 or ithaca 37 or something like that in 20 guage and chop it down. It will have a little more recoil than your 410, but not near as much as a 12 and will be lots easier to find one of these. A 28 guage would be good too. but they are kinda scarce also in the low end pump arena. More in the nice double end of the spectrum for trap and skeet. Good luck on your search.

I finally got around to calling Mossberg and they do offer a replacement barrel for it in 18 1/2" for $75.00.

I think after I get a few Christmas bills paid, I'll be getting that on its way. At least that way, I'll preserve it's existing condition and not have to hack it up.

And just for the sake of conclusion, I did get an email reply from Tapco that confirmed that one of their T-6 style stocks will fit the .410.

So it looks like I'll be able to get it set up how I want it without too much trouble or making drastic modifications.
